Census History

Official Decennial Census counts. Each is an enumeration taken on April 1 of its census year, separate from the annual estimates above.

Official Decennial Census counts by census year.
CensusPopulation
2010 Census403,892
2020 Census467,665

Sources & Methodology

The current population figure is an annual estimate from the U.S. Census Bureau's Population Estimates Program. The 2020 Census is shown separately as the official benchmark.

Current estimate506,306 · July 1, 2025

U.S. Census Bureau — Subcounty Resident Population Estimates (SUB-EST2025), Vintage 2025

Official Census467,665 · April 1, 2020

U.S. Census Bureau — 2020 Census Redistricting Data (P.L. 94-171), table P1

These figures can differ because the Census and annual population estimates are produced at different times using different methods. Both are shown so you can distinguish the most current estimate from the official Census benchmark.

How the change since 2020 is calculated

Both endpoints come from the same Census Bureau Population Estimates Program release, so the comparison is like for like: 466,310 on July 1, 2020 and 506,306 on July 1, 2025. The change is the later estimate minus the earlier one (+39,996), and the percentage is that change divided by the 2020 estimate (+8.6%). The Decennial Census count is never used as an endpoint here — it is an enumeration on a different reference date, produced by a different method, so subtracting one from the other would measure the difference between two methods as well as the change in population.
